Stump grinding is the process of removing a tree stump using specialized equipment that grinds the wood down below ground level. Instead of digging out the entire root system, we grind the stump into mulch, leaving your yard smooth, level, and ready for grass, plants, or landscaping.
At StumpOut Stump Grinding, we can handle stumps of nearly all sizes—from small decorative tree stumps to large, mature tree bases. Our professional-grade equipment is designed to grind down even wide and deeply rooted stumps efficiently.
The size of the stump may affect the time it takes to complete the job, but it typically does not limit whether it can be removed. Whether your stump is just a few inches across or several feet wide, we have the tools and experience to get the job done safely and effectively.
We typically grind stumps 6–12 inches below ground level, which is deep enough to prevent regrowth and allow for new landscaping. If you have specific plans like planting or building over the area, we can grind deeper upon request.
